Featured Post

How to Optimize Machine Learning Models for Performance

Optimizing machine learning models for performance is a crucial step in the model development process. A model that is not optimized may pro...

Saturday, January 1, 2022

Machine Learning for Computer Vision: Recognizing Images and Videos

Computer vision is a field of artificial intelligence that deals with the ability of machines to interpret and understand visual information from the world, such as images and videos. Machine learning is a key technology used in computer vision, as it enables machines to learn from data and improve their ability to recognize and understand visual information.

One of the most common applications of machine learning for computer vision is image recognition. Image recognition algorithms can be trained to identify objects, scenes, and activities in images. For example, a machine learning model can be trained to recognize a person's face in an image, or to identify the type of vehicle in a traffic scene.

Another important application of machine learning for computer vision is object detection. Object detection algorithms can be trained to locate and classify objects within an image or video. For example, a machine learning model can be trained to detect pedestrians in a traffic scene, or to locate a specific object within an image, such as a stop sign.

Machine learning for computer vision is also used in video analysis. Video analysis algorithms can be trained to detect and track objects, recognize activities and extract information from videos. For example, a machine learning model can be trained to identify a person in a video, track their movement and recognize their actions, such as walking or running.

In addition to these applications, machine learning for computer vision is also used in other areas such as image segmentation, image restoration, and 3D reconstruction. Machine learning for computer vision is a rapidly growing field, with many new developments and breakthroughs being made in recent years. With the increasing availability of large amounts of data and powerful computing resources, machine learning models are becoming more accurate and robust, making it possible to use them in a wide range of applications, from security and surveillance to self-driving cars and medical imaging.

Overall, machine learning for computer vision is a powerful technology that has the potential to revolutionize the way machines understand and interpret visual information. It can be used to solve a wide range of problems and will continue to play an important role in the development of intelligent systems in the future.